MarketAxess Holdings, Inc. operates an electronic trading platform that allows investment industry professionals to trade corporate bonds and other types of fixed-income instruments. It also provides automated and algorithmic trading products in equities and foreign exchange. The company operates through the Americas, Europe, and Asia geographical segments. It was founded by Richard Mitchell McVey on April 11, 2000, and is headquartered in New York, NY.
